Sunset - Lake of the Woods offers a picturesque campground with spacious, well-maintained sites and easy access to a beautiful lake. Many guests appreciate the cleanliness of the restrooms and the friendliness of the camp hosts, making for a pleasant camping experience. However, some visitors have reported issues with caterpillars and mosquitoes, as well as a desire for shower facilities and more electrical hookup sites.

Location Sunset - Lake of the Woods (OR)
Address:
15300 Dead Indian Memorial Rd.
Klamath Falls, OR, 97601
United States
From Klamath Falls, go 32 miles northwest on Highway 140. Turn south on Dead Indian Memorial road and continue approximately 2.5 miles to the campground.
Sunset Campground is accessible via Oregon State Highway 140, which is approximately 15 miles to the south.
Latitude & Longitude: 42.3722 / -122.197
Elevation: 1567 feet
Policies & Rules
Arrival & departure
Check in time
2PM
Check out time
1PM
General
- Sites may be available on a first-come, first-served basis
- Four Electric hookups sites are available. Sites 3, 4 and 6, 7.
- Additional vehicle parking is $10 per night
- Click here for more information about Fremont-Winema National Forest
- Don't Move Firewood: Please protect Pacific Northwest forests by preventing the spread of invasive species. Firewood can carry insects and diseases that can threaten the health of our western forests. You can make a difference by obtaining and burning your firewood near your camping destination.
